Output 881ea3597f5894962fa9e34694eac1c2714837a302ab4064967e9594e59dd34a:781

value
105469
script pubkey
OP_0 OP_PUSHBYTES_20 ebc144c962511e3c2d1db410c5b4680e4efd4cba
address
ltc1qa0q5fjtz2y0rctgaksgvtdrgpe806n96gy4zkg
transaction
881ea3597f5894962fa9e34694eac1c2714837a302ab4064967e9594e59dd34a
spent
false